Unlike computer skills or other technical skills, there is a disinclination on the part of many people to recognize the degree to which their analytical skills are weak.
Unlike computer skills or other technical skills, which they admit they lack, many people are disinclined to recognize that their analytical skills are weak.
Unlike computer skills or other technical skills, analytical skills bring out a disinclination in many people to recognize that they are weak to a degree.
Many people, willing to admit that they lack computer skills or other technical skills, are disinclined to recognize that their analytical skills are weak.
Many people have a disinclination to recognize the weakness of their analytical skills while willing to admit their lack of computer skills or other technical skills.
题目分析:
略
选项分析:
A选项:unlike连接的两者在逻辑上不对等,其连接的是computer skills or other technical skills和there。在逻辑上具有对比关系的两者是computer skills or other technical skills和analytical skills。
B选项:unlike连接的两者是computer skills or other technical skills和many people,两者不可比错误同选项(A)。
C选项:本选项的迷惑性较高。真正的错误在于名词短语a disinclination in many people to recognize。其至少需要改为动名词短语many people’s disinclining to recognize。这点考查了名词和动名词的区别。用之于本题,disincline是“不情愿”的意思,这是很多人的一种状态,在语境中没有给出这种不情愿会在何时终止。因此,disincline不能用名词短语。
D选项:Correct. 本选项在语法和逻辑上均是正确的。
E选项:本选项的主干为:
Many people have a disinclination
其讲的是:很多人拥有一个不情愿。但在逻辑上,应是很多人主动发出“不情愿”这个动作,而不是他们拥有这个不情愿。例如,我们可以说:
Jack hits the stone. (杰克打石头)
但不能说:
**Jack has the hitting of the stone. (**杰克拥有石头的打)
